[Ubuntu-BR] Programar para linux
Andre Cavalcante
andre.d.cavalcante em gmail.com
Sexta Agosto 14 18:13:01 UTC 2009
2009/8/14 Felipe Tanus <wallacethescot em gmail.com>
>
> OI,
>
> C não é somente para kernel.
Concordo plenamente. Até hoje, boa parte dos meus programas são C puro.
Evito ao máximo o C++, principalmente porque fa,co coisas simples...
>
> Você deve usar C em programas que a performance do seja muito
> importante.
Ou simplesmente pela simplicidade e rapidez no desenvolvimento...
>
> Normalmente se usa orientação a objetos para quando a performance não é
> tão importante por uma vasta quantidade de motivos. Aconselho a leitura
> sobre paradigmas de programação, como procedural(C) e orientado a
> objetos(C++). Pode ser na wikipedia mesmo.
Ou quando a complexidade aumenta e vale a pena perder um pouco de tempo
planejando a tua hierarquia de classes e objetos
> Você pode programar em C com GTK se quiser, porém você _vai_ querer
> programar em C++;
> Sobre como funciona uma programação gráfica, que imagino que você não
> tenha feito nada ainda, a "conversão de video" ou qualquer outra "tarefa"
> você vai acabar fazendo do mesmo jeito que faz sem ser em um programa
> gráfico; só precisa pegar a sua incrivel função de conversão e atribuir a
> um
> botão, digamos assim, pegando como entrada(ou não) valores dos elementos da
> janela (digamos, por exemplo, o filme que você quer converter em uma área
> de
> texto)
Felipe, sou muito pouco experiente nisso, mas usando o Glade, essa parte da
associação não fica dentro do XML? Sinceramente, os exemplos que fiz, e que
foram BEEEMMM simples, basicamente usei os ponteiros dos tipos estabelecidos
na api, não precisei realmente de C++. Para coisas mais complexas talvez
seja realmente relevante, não sei...
--
André Cavalcante
Porto Alegre, RS.
Ubuntu User number # 24370
Quer saber sobre Open Source Software? http://sobreoss.blogspot.com
Atenção: Este e-mail pode conter anexos no formato ODF (Open Document
Format)/ABNT (extensões odt, ods, odp, odb, odg). Antes de pedir os anexos
em outro formato, você pode instalar gratuita e livremente o BrOffice (
http://www.broffice.org) ou o seguinte Plugin para Microsoft Office (
http://www.sun.com/software/star/odf_plugin/get.jsp).
More information about the ubuntu-br
mailing list